The Importance of Inexpensive Daycare
Affordable daycare is really important for working households who rely on childcare solutions to assist them to balance their work and household obligations. Without usage of inexpensive daycare, many parents are obligated to make difficult alternatives, such as quitting their particular jobs or reducing their working hours so that you can care for kids. This may have a significant affect their particular economic security and general well-being.
Affordable daycare solutions may also have a confident impact on kids development. Research indicates that kids whom attend high-quality daycare programs will succeed academically and socially later in life. By giving children with a safe and stimulating environment, affordable daycare will help them develop important skills and build a stronger foundation for their future.
Also, inexpensive daycare may also gain the economy by enabling even more moms and dads to be involved in the workforce. When moms and dads gain access to inexpensive childcare, these are typically very likely to manage to work full time and subscribe to the economic climate. This could lead to increased efficiency, higher family incomes, and overall economic development.
Challenges of Affordable Daycare
Inspite of the importance of inexpensive daycare, many families continue steadily to battle to find high quality treatment at an acceptable cost. The sought after for childcare solutions, coupled with restricted accessibility and high running prices, has made it difficult for most daycare providers to supply affordable prices to families.
One of the main challenges of inexpensive daycare is the high cost of staffing. Skilled childcare providers are crucial for delivering high-quality care to children, but hiring and maintaining skilled staff could be pricey. So that expenses reduced, some daycare providers may compromise on top-notch treatment or run with restricted sources, that could have unfavorable consequences for kids and families.
Another challenge of inexpensive daycare may be the decreased federal government help and money. Though some nations offer subsidies or income tax credits to assist people protect the cost of childcare, many households nevertheless struggle to pay for quality care. Without adequate government help, daycare providers might obligated to raise their particular rates or reduce their particular services, making it also harder for families to get into inexpensive attention.
